unable to PM due to me not posting on this forum/having next to nothing in post counts.had some issues getting the parts as all but 1 housing got delivered to my local dealers, i ended up just using a terminal tool to manually swap the pins on my current wiring harness's and it works like a charm. can pick up the terminal tool for around £10 or less on ebay and i can direct you as to what pins go where on the 9n if you want?. its less than a 5 minute job.
Or if you want i can make the adapters. but its a lot more cost effective just actually buying a terminal tool and changing it yourself.

I used a "Laser 3932 Terminal Tool"
